A distressed livestream where Psyche deals with repeated attacks on his channel, including chat disruptions and being kicked from Discord servers on the anniversary of his father's death.
Open PanelThis episode captures Psyche in an extremely vulnerable and emotional state on the anniversary of his father's death. He begins by explaining that he had to restart his stream multiple times due to chat being disabled by a moderator named Alexander who was reportedly doxing people. Psyche expresses frustration about being removed from various Discord servers and feeling attacked by people he considered friends. The stream becomes increasingly raw as he discusses his struggles with being gay in the streaming community, his concerns about providing for his cats, and feeling constantly judged or excluded. The latter portion features an extended conversation with J-Dog about massage parlors, gender verification, and hypothetical emergency scenarios, which becomes uncomfortable and ends with J-Dog leaving. Throughout, Psyche oscillates between anger, hurt, and attempts at humor while seeking validation from his audience.
